Output 2c45397c8ee74233deaebd8715b4756821be380fd98de6bc2a8d95fe24b9400a:1

value
9999763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ddcd5143ba3ab622adff341b217b28677a66aa OP_EQUAL
address
3MBqZUh4me8vuZSJp7gNRa2XVixSSxnbNe
transaction
2c45397c8ee74233deaebd8715b4756821be380fd98de6bc2a8d95fe24b9400a
spent
true